Raymond R. Giard, 89, formerly of Mendon Rd., died Saturday in Bayberry Commons, Pascoag. Mr. Giard was the husband of Albertine (Charette) Giard. He was born in Woonsocket, a son of the late Zotique and Leona (Picard) Giard. Mr. Giard was a lifelong city resident, and along with his brother the late Lionel Giard, was an owner/operator of Giard's Cleaners on Cumberland St. in Woonsocket for over forty years. Mr. Giard was also a WWII army veteran.
Besides his wife, he is survived by five children; Raymond Giard of Aberdeen, MD, Roger Giard of Chepachet, Lorraine Giard , Doris Sweeney, and Claire Giard, all of Woonsocket, five grandchildren, ten great grand children, and one sister Florence Courschesne of Woonsocket.
